DBT? Anyone tried?

I’ve come across DBT which is dialectical behaviour therapy, and was wondering if anyone who suffers with low mood and anxiety have tried?

  • Yes I’ve had DBT. A long time ago mind, I did the course 3 times, last time was in 2009. It was helpful, it’s primarily for borderline personality disorder, but it’s one of those things that if you put the effort in you’ll get the rewards from it, it you just go and not really engage you won’t. You really do have to practice what you learn in order for the therapy to be effective. It helped me overcome 20 years of self harm so I can vouch for its effectiveness. If you can get on the course I would definitely recommend doing it, it’s a lot different than CBT, more intense but it is worth it.

    With all the skills learned, you’ll find there’s some that are more helpful than others, I guess it depends on what your main issues are. The distress tolerance section was what I found most useful, as well as the mindfulness stuff.
